A Layman's Search for Salvation: My Journey

A Layman's Search for Salvation is the absorbing chronicle of a young black man's search for meaning during the late 1950s. Author Allen Carter Jr.'s quest leads him from Texas to California where he is introduced to a new Protestant denomination of German Scandinavian origin-Lutheranism. This newly discovered awareness comes by way of a local black pastor who serves a predominately white congregation. The members are warm and friendly, exemplifying a Christ-like love, and Allen and his family enthusiastically embrace the group. But things fall apart when the pastor is reassigned to another locale. His departure leaves a huge void, as he is the linchpin keeping this unique group of believers anchored. Ultimately, the pastor's departure is the death knell for the flock as members soon scatter. Now the young man is much like a lost sheep left without a shepherd. His long and arduous spiritual journey intensifies, leading him through the spiritual chambers of change, growth, and understanding, which galvanize his resolve to know Christ.
